today, i spent most of the day in the library coding an Excel spreadsheet to analyze the marks from a standardized reading test that was done earlier in the school year for the grade 7/8 class. it took a long time because a) i'm not a programmer; b) i've forgotten most of Excel; c) i'm way too ambitious about spreadsheets sometimes.

the analysis called for counting the number of students in each level per question by gender. i thought a handy COUNTIF function would suffice as i use it all the time for counting things in columns that fit a certain criteria. unfortunately, the AND function does not work in conjunction with COUNTIFs. after devising a crude workaround (sorting by gender and COUNTIFfing for those specific ranges) i happened upon a new function: SUMPRODUCT.

this function operates with arrays, which allows me to basically do a count with multiple criteria. here's the tutorial i found just after i printed out the poorly coded version. so i spent about half an hour editing everything with SUMPRODUCT formulas instead of COUNTIFs.

ex. =SUMPRODUCT((B2:B50="M")*(C2:C50=3))
to count the number of male students who scored a Level 3 on the first part of the first question.

In Europe and North America, tally marks are most commonly written as groups of five lines. The first four lines are vertical, and every fifth line runs diagonally or horizontally across the previous four vertical lines, in either of the two possible directions (the popular direction may vary from region to region). The resulting mark is known as a five-bar gate, from its similarity to the same. [...]

Chinese, Korean and Japanese tally marks use the five strokes of 正 which is the character meaning "correct" "proper" and "honesty."

when you sign up with a matchmaking service, you undergo rigorous psychological testing to determine your personality in finite, objective terms; it's a questionnaire. the results of your test are plotted into a vector generator. a vector is like a coordinate (x, y), but has an anchor at (0, 0), thus forming a line. the vector of your personality, lets call it [y1, y2, y3, ... yn], is then dropped into a databank of other desperate lonely folk's personality vectors and a computer runs them through a stiff algorithm: the dot product.

finding the dot product between two vectors is quite fun. you take the number in the first dimension from one vector and multiply it with the number in the first dimension of the other vector and add it to the product of the numbers in the second dimenion and the third and so on:
x dot y = x1y1 + x2y2 + ... xnyn.

this is equivalent to the product of the two vector's magnitudes (lengths) and the cosine of the angle between the two:
x dot y = |x||y|cos(theta).

the computer solves for the angle and uses it to determine the strength of compatibility. really small angles between two vectors mean that they are very similar, and therefore compatible. angles of around 180 degrees are also considered compatible since opposites attract. the computer then compiles a list of candidates for each person based on the data.

according to kinetic molecular theory, everything that has even a smidgen of energy in it -- i.e. has a temperature greater than absolute zero -- is vibrating. by and large, macroscopic objects vibrate very slowly, so you're unlikely to notice them doing so. this vibration is usually referred to as natural frequency: the number of times an object oscillates (moves back and forth) in one second, measured in units of Hz.

have you seen the physics demonstration of two equivalent tuning forks affixed to sound chambers? ringing one fork results in the other ringing apparently on its own accord, without any visible connection (wires, etc) between the two. click here to watch.

this happens because tuning forks of equivalent frequencies resonate with each other (and anything else with a similar natural frequency). when a tuning fork is struck, the tines vibrate at their natural frequency, compressing the air in regular intervals, thus generating a sound at that frequency. when an equivalent tuning fork is held near, the air compressions (sound waves) push against this new fork's tines in regular intervals -- the same intervals, or frequency, as that of their origin.

if you impart a force, even a very small one, at the same frequency as an object's natural frequency, it will move, regardless of how big it is relative to the force. think of it like this: a big kid is sitting on a swing and wants his little sister, who is 1/3 his size, to push him really high. since it is physically impossible for her to do so with one push, she does the smart thing and gives little pushes every time her brother reaches the apex of the swing, just as gravity begins to pull him forward again. eventually, the swing will have accrued enough energy to make the boy happy. same thing with the tuning forks. little bursts of air pressure at the natural frequency of a metal tuning fork can set it in motion. even on something as large as a bridge, resonance can move the entire structure.

frequency can also be understood as wavelength; since everything has a frequency, everything has a wavelength, and is thus a wave. when waves meet, they combine together (superposition principle) by adding together. crests adding to crests makes bigger crests; troughs adding to troughs make deeper troughs, etc. this is called interference. resonance is an example of constructive interference, when everything lines up to make the wave amplitude greater. conversely, there is destructive interference, in which the waves add up to reduce the amplitude.

Last Friday marked the premiere of Battlestar Galactica's final season. In Canada, it is on the Space Channel, Fridays at 10 pm.

For the uninitiated, the premise of the re-imagined version of BSG follows that of the original 1970 version (which was really campy and obviously trying to play off the popularity of Star Wars, Star Trek and Bonanza). Somewhere in the galaxy are 12 planets, colonized by humans originating from the planet Kobol. The human race developed an artificial intelligence and manufactured machines to do their work called Cylons (a la Terminator, The Matrix, Blade Runner and a host of other science fiction plotlines). Realizing their lot in life was a bit of a raw deal, the Cylons rebelled, and a great war was fought. During the course of this war, the humans and Cylons reached an armistice (peace agreement); for 40 years they lived apart, the humans with their 12 colonies and the Cylons finding their own region of space. The truce is broken suddenly when the Cylons launch a surprise, all-out offensive that decimates the 12 Colonies in a flourish of nuclear strikes. Battlestar Galactica is the story about the survivors, a rag-tag fleet of ships being led in a glactic convoy to safe harbour and possibly a new home by the Battlestar Galactica, the sole remnant of a once vast military force.

What sets this show apart from the original (and the 1980s reboot) and other space exploration shows? Firstly, they nuked the campiness that drove the original to an early, merciful demise. Unlike most science fiction shows floating around, the technology and alien themes that litter those lesser shows take a backseat to true storytelling: character drama, political/sociological/moral/philosophical dilemmas and a rich tapestry of moods (primarily post-apocalyptic darkness). This show was developed around the same time Joss Whedon's Firefly was in production. There are similarities between the two, especially the way both shows eschew the clean cut sterility of 20th Century futurism, opting instead for a grittier, dirtier realism (through documentary-style filming) and exploration of current themes and questions against a backdrop of space.
